`XmlConvert.ToString()` uses ISO-8601 representation (ie `PT8H6M12.345S`)?
I see no info on the MSDN: https://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/z1955e3x
We are using `PTnHnMnS` as defined by java Duration:
https://docs.oracle.com/javase/8/docs/api/java/time/Duration.html#toString--
